  • 60The Crystal Collector visits Franklin, North Carolina to check out one of the only unsalted legit ruby and sapphire mines in the country! You will see the amazing ruby finds happen in front of your own eyes! This location is a premier site to take your family to for a short vacation or trip. Many people have had such a great fun time at this location for over 100 years! See these ruby crystals light up using a longwave UV light, bringing them to a bright glow!
    If you're interested in ruby gems, then be sure to watch this video! We'll discuss the history of the ruby mine and describe the types of ruby gems that have been found there.0

    Franklin North Carolina is also home to the annual gem and lapidary wholesale show which is not as big as the show in Tucson but it’s the next biggest after Tucson and if you can’t go to Tucson but you can go to Franklin North Carolina. It’s worth your while. Franklin, North Carolina is also home to the worlds largest sapphire in the museum section of the local gem shop.

    My family ran the Jacob's Ruby Mine from around 1995 to 2001. (Right next to Shuler, Holbrook and Gibson, the 3 original mines.) Most of the unsalted mines are gone. Glad there's a little left. The heyday was probably 1950's to 1990's although lots of salted mines the last few decades in that time range.
